No.21: Ensure your hashtags are accessible.

It’s a great tip in general to ensure that everything is accessible on your website and other communications. Anything that improves clarity is good for everyone.

On social media and LinkedIn, when you include multi-word hashtags, make sure you now capitalise the first letter from each word (e.g. #WebsiteWednesday). This simple step doesn’t affect the reach of each hashtag, but makes them much easier to read, especially for people with certain visual impairments.

Note, technically, these are called ‘Title Case’ hashtags (or ‘Pascal Case’ or ‘Camel Case’ hashtags for some reason).
